Dhurbtara, surely this route can be done in Chardham yatra. The road condition is almost good leaving some bad parts here and there. Specially the first 28 km from Uttarkashi to Chaurangi khal and the last 38 km from Ghansali to Tilwada were just perfect.

It would be advisable if you make Dehradun as your base and take a rental car. Once you have rented a car with driver, You could make day trips to Chakrata ,Mussoorie,Dhanaulti, Chamba,Dev Prayag, Tehri, Asan Bird Sanctuary, Dakpatthar, Various tibetan settlements. These places are worth exploring if you have never been there earlier. If you are more interested in hiking in high mountains, you could rest for a day in dehradun/rishikesh and then move on to either yamunotri highway or Badrinath highway. Do your bookings in advance as finding a reasonable accomodation may not be very easy in peak season. However, you will always find some shelter in every single town pparticularly on your way to Badrinath.

Thee is always the possibility of Tatkal booking, but you should check also check for availability on the ANVT-KGM train (if you haven't already). Other than that, there are also a/c deluxe buses from Delhi Anand Vihar to Haldwani a few times a day. Generally no problem to get seats if you are there 1 hour in advance.
You can then hire a car for the hill section. See the Car Rental in Kumaon thread for contact details.
